Course Outline
Overview of Project Management Methodologies
- Agile Methodologies
- Waterfall
Automated Deployment via GIT
- Production repository
- Release branch
- Utilizing Tags for releases
- Switching between releases
- Managing maintenance releases
- Major releases
Documentation and Release Change Logs
- Generating Change Logs from Repository History
- Using Tag descriptions to summarize major release changes
- Consolidating minor changes into broader business-oriented updates
- Aggregating commits
- Organizing commits into logical groupings
Push and Pull Strategies for Central Repositories
- Maintaining a clean Central repository
- Establishing structures for aggregating and reviewing developer changes
- Testing and Staging environments
Software Architecture and Components
- Logically dividing applications and repositories
- Managing third-party libraries and subprojects
- Leveraging submodules to automate upgrades
Requirements
A foundational familiarity with GIT is recommended.
Participants are required to have a solid understanding of the software development life cycle, as well as project management methodologies and frameworks such as Waterfall and Agile.
